This is my Tile we made them through our art week.
Mr S did a workshop on these tiles.
How we made them was we got coffee cups and scoped about one and a half to two cups of sand into our ice cream then we used another ice cream container to flatten the sand down.
Next we got shapes you could have your initials, pineapples, teddy bears and much more. We held them up so they would face the right way and we would put them straight back down without doing anything to the shapes.
Then Mr S made concrete mixture and poured it in, DRY DRY DRY.
They were ready to be painted, the first sort of paint was spray paint, we got the options of blue, green, orange and purple. DRY DRY DRY. The next sort of paint was paint brush paint, as you can see in the picture above I painted the top of my pineapple green and the bottom yellow, I painted my initials red.
